使用C语言解决杨辉三角形问题
杨辉三角形简介
杨辉三角形作为数学史上的重要概念,具有许多规律。其中包括每个数等于它上方两数之和,以及每行数字左右对称逐渐增大等规律。
C语言解决方法
要用C语言解决杨辉三角形问题,首先需要了解这些规律。通过设立一个数组来存储数据,并设置两个整数来控制内外层循环,可以很好地实现这一目标。
实现代码展示
以下是使用C语言编写的代码示例:
```c
include
int main() {
int rows, coef 1;
printf("Enter number of rows: ");
scanf("%d", rows);
for (int i 0; i < rows; i ) {
for (int space 1; space < rows - i; space) {
printf(" ");
}
for (int j 0; j < i; j ) {
if (j 0 || i 0)
coef 1;
else
coef coef * (i - j 1) / j;
printf("M", coef);
}
printf("
");
}
return 0;
}
```
运行结果
当你运行以上代码时,将会输出所需行数的杨辉三角形。这种利用C语言解决杨辉三角形问题的方法既实用又具有教育意义,希望能够激发更多人对C语言编程的兴趣。
通过以上介绍,相信读者对如何使用C语言解决杨辉三角形问题有了更清晰的认识,也希未读者能够在实践中加深对C语言的理解与运用。
版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。